71919 ACDGA/HCP4AL Bearing Product Overview & Core Advantages
The 71919 ACDGA/HCP4AL is a high-precision angular contact ball bearing designed for demanding applications requiring exceptional accuracy and performance. Engineered to accommodate combined loads (simultaneous radial and axial loads), this bearing features a 25° contact angle optimized for high axial load capacity. Its P4A tolerance class ensures ultra-precision operation, while the ceramic balls and phenolic cage contribute to superior high-speed capabilities and reduced weight. This configuration is ideal for machine tool spindles and other high-rigidity, high-rotation accuracy applications.
71919 ACDGA/HCP4AL Bearing Model Code Explained, Specifications & Naming Convention
| Suffix Code | Technical Meaning |
|---|---|
| AC | Angular Contact design with a 25° contact angle. |
| D | High Ball Complement design for increased load capacity. |
| GA | Universal Matchable (SU) bearing in a set of 3, preloaded to Extra light / Class A. |
| HC | Hybrid Ceramic balls (Silicon Nitride), offering higher speed, reduced weight, and longer service life. |
| P4A | Super-precision tolerance class with enhanced running accuracy for the most demanding applications. |
71919 ACDGA/HCP4AL Bearing Structural Features & Performance Benefits
- High Rigidity and Precision: The single-row angular contact design, combined with the P4A tolerance class and tight dimensional tolerances on the bearing dimensions (bore, OD, and width), provides exceptional rotational accuracy and system stiffness.
- Superior Load Capacity: The 25° contact angle and high ball complement (28 balls) enable the bearing to handle significant combined loads, making it suitable for applications with high axial and radial force components.
- Exceptional High-Speed Performance: The combination of ceramic balls (lower density, reduced centrifugal force) and a lightweight phenolic cage allows for a very high limiting speed of 16,000 rpm, minimizing heat generation and power loss.
- Pre-Lubricated and Open Design: The bearing comes lubricated for immediate use and features an open (non-shielded) seal type, which is optimal for systems with centralized lubrication or where maximum speed is the priority.
